READING, Pa. – The Arcadia University men's cross country team competed in the Plex Shootout hosted by Alvernia University on Saturday.
The Knights had three more Middle Atlantic Conference (MAC) Championship qualifying performances and broke four program records.

HOW IT HAPPENED
-
Ben Williamson broke the program 5K record while meeting qualifying standards with a time of 16:15.48 for 11
th place.
-
Brendan Blyth qualified in the mile with a school record breaking time of 4:36.15 (seventh place).
-
Wesley Castelli qualified for MACs in the 400m run (53.51). He finished fourth overall in this event.
-
Matthew Schutz broke his own school record in the pole vault with a height of 4.05m for a fifth-place finish.
-
Myles Sams finished second overall in the 200m dash with a program record breaking time of 23.11.
